How to save excessively and re -heating
This sweet potato hash is the best that is made for crisp sweet potatoes and bacon.
- Fridge: Save left overs in an Airtite container for 4 days.
- To re -heating it: Microwave it in a 20-second increment until it is heated. You can also use a pan on medium high heat for 8-10 minutes to move.

- Praise a large nonstick skilllet on a medium high flame.
- Add bacon to the pan. Cook until bacon crisp, about 3-5 minutes.
- Using a slotted spoon or thorns, remove the bacon from the pan and separate it.
- Add dysted sweet potatoes to the pan (including bacon grease). Toss to coat the sweet potato with bacon grease so they are not stuck in the pan.
- Make the potatoes with smoking paparika, rosemary, thyme, salt and raw garlic. Toss to mix everything together.
- Continue to sot the sweet potatoes until sometimes the shake is shaken. About 10-12 minutes.
- Heat another skillet in a medium high.
- Spray with cooking spray or add 1 tablespoon grape seed oil.
- Add eggs to the pan and cook at your desired temperature.
- Serve the eggs on top of 1 cup of sweet potato hash. Serve the adjacent cut avocado.
